An immunoassay measures the presence or concentration of macromolecules found in a solution. To determine this measurement it uses an antibody or immunoglobulin.

Immunoassay interference refers to factors that can impact the accuracy of immunoassay test results by causing false positive or false negative outcomes. These interferences can be due to the presence of substances in the sample that can cross-react with the assay components, leading to incorrect measurements. It is important to identify and minimize immunoassay interferences to ensure the reliability of test results.

Titration is a laboratory method used to determine the concentration of a solution by reacting it with a solution of known concentration. It is commonly used to measure the concentration of acids and bases, as well as other substances in solution.

The most commonly used measure of concentration for an aqueous solution is molarity, which is the number of moles of solute per liter of solution.

A hydrometer or a refractometer can be used to measure the salinity level of a saline solution. These tools are specifically designed to measure the concentration of dissolved salts in a liquid.
